Detailed description of the invention
In conjunction with the accompanying drawings, the present invention is further detailed explanation.These accompanying drawings are the schematic diagram of simplification, only with
The basic structure of the illustration explanation present invention, therefore it only shows the composition relevant with the present invention.
As shown in Figure 1-Figure 3, a kind of high steady type flood protection device for flood control works, including door-plate 2, it is arranged on door-plate
The doorframe 6 of 2 one end, the drive mechanism being arranged on door-plate 2 other end and two sealing frames being separately positioned on door-plate about 2 two ends
1;
It is provided with the first retention mechanism 7 between described door-plate 2 and doorframe 6, between described door-plate 2 and sealing frame 1, is provided with second
Retention mechanism, described first retention mechanism 7;
Described first retention mechanism 7 include the first rotary electric machine 12 and two be separately positioned on the first rotary electric machine 12 two ends
Limit assembly, described limit assembly includes drive link 13, limited block 14 and the stopper slot 15 being arranged on door-plate 2, described
One rotary electric machine 12 is in transmission connection with limited block 14 by the first rotary electric machine 12, described limited block 14 be positioned at stopper slot 15 and
Mating with stopper slot 15, described first rotary electric machine 12 is fixed on doorframe 6;
Described second retention mechanism includes the second rotary electric machine 3, limit shaft 4 and the spacing hole 5 being arranged on door-plate 2, institute
Stating the second rotary electric machine 3 to be arranged in sealing frame 1, described second rotary electric machine 3 is in transmission connection with limit shaft 4, described limit shaft 4
The other end be positioned at spacing hole 5 and mate with spacing hole 5.
As preferably, in order to ensure the reliability that door-plate 2 cuts out, described drive mechanism includes driving motor 9, drive shaft 10
With hold-down support 11, described driving motor 9 is in transmission connection with hold-down support 11 by drive shaft 10.
As preferably, during in order to prevent door-plate 2 and doorframe 6 from closing, collision is excessively fierce, between described door-plate 2 and doorframe 6
Being additionally provided with buffer gear 8, described buffer gear 8 includes shell 16, buffer spring 17 and buffer sliding block 18, described shell 16 interior
Portion is provided with groove, and the notch of described groove is near doorframe 6, and described buffer sliding block 18 is positioned at the notch of groove, described buffer sliding block
18 are connected with the bottom of groove by buffer spring 17.
As preferably, in order to end of door plate 2 and doorframe 6 buffer when closing, described buffer sliding block 18 is block rubber, described
On the doorframe 6 and position corresponding with buffer sliding block 18 is provided with dashpot, and described dashpot mates with buffer sliding block 18.
As preferably, one end of described buffer sliding block 18 is fillet, and described dashpot is horn mouth.
As preferably, in order to improve the reliability of fastening between door-plate 2 and doorframe 6, described first rotary electric machine 12 and the
Two rotary electric machines 3 are direct current generator.
As preferably, in order to improve the sustainable ability to work of flood protection device, the inside of described door-plate 2 is provided with accumulator,
Described accumulator is trifluoro lithium battery.
As preferably, in order to increase the alarm indication function of flood protection device, described door-plate 2 is additionally provided with alarm lamp
19, described alarm lamp 19 is dichromatic LED.
This is used in the high steady type flood protection device of flood control works, opening between driving mechanisms control door-plate 2 and doorframe 6
Close.When closedown puts in place between door-plate 2 and doorframe 6, then ensure consolidating between door-plate 2 and doorframe 6 by the first retention mechanism 7
Property, ensure the steadiness between door-plate 2 and sealing frame 1 by the second retention mechanism.
In first retention mechanism 7 of this high steady type flood protection device being used for flood control works, the first rotary electric machine 12 passes through
Drive link 13 controls the rotation of limited block 14 so that limited block 14 can be embedded in the stopper slot 15 specified, subsequently when door-plate 2
And when reaching to specify position between doorframe 6, will mate between limited block 14 with stopper slot 15, it is ensured that door-plate 2 and doorframe 6 it
Between stable firmly.
This is used in second retention mechanism of high steady type flood protection device of flood control works, and the second rotary electric machine 3 rotates limit
Position axle 4, then in limit shaft 4 will be embedded into spacing hole 5 so that spacing hole 5 fastens with limit shaft 4, then be achieved that door-plate 2 and
Stablize firmly between sealing frame 1.
This is used in the buffer gear 8 of high steady type flood protection device of flood control works, door-plate 2 and doorframe 6 close to time, then
Groove in doorframe 6 will come in contact with buffer sliding block 18, buffers now by buffer spring 17, it is ensured that door-plate 2
With the buffering of doorframe 6, improve the reliability of flood protection device.
